Associate professor (non-tenure track) in computational science and artificial intelligence degree programmes
The Department of Computational Engineering at the LUT School of Engineering Sciences is seeking an associate professor (non-tenure track) in the field of computational science and artificial intelligence degree programmes.
The main duties will include
- developing education at the national and international levels and coordinating administrative tasks in the degree programmes
- teaching basic and intermediate courses in computational engineering and artificial intelligence
- contributing to the department's research activities.
The department hosts the Flagship of Advanced Mathematics for Sensing, Imaging and Modelling (FAME), funded by the Research Council of Finland. Current research areas of the department include inverse problems, numerical analysis, computational statistics, computer vision and pattern recognition.
What we are looking for
Applicants are expected to have a doctoral degree in a field relevant to the position, such as a DSc or PhD degree. In addition, the regulations of LUT University require that an associate professor (non-tenure track) has the pedagogical competences and teaching skills necessary for the position, proof of high-level research work and publications, and the ability to lead a research group and raise research funding. Experience in Finnish university education is considered beneficial.
The position is part of LUT University's non-tenure track, where promotions are based on tenure track criteria. The employment relationship is fixed-term for four years with a six-month trial period. At the end of the four-year term, the position may be made permanent after a successful promotion review.

Salary
The salary is determined according to the salary system for university teaching and research personnel. The typical gross starting salary for an associate professor (non-tenure track) is approximately 57 500-66 300 euros a year (plus a holiday bonus in accordance with the collective agreement), depending on the qualifications and experience of the candidate and the responsibilities agreed on.
The job is based in Lappeenranta, Finland.
